BEST first class from Italy to jfk

BEST first class from Italy to jfk

  1. Anonymous Guest

    i am looking to book a one way trip from Italy to jfk. I want the BEST experience I can get. I have 250000 points on American Express platinum and 150000onchase sapphire. I think I would need to supplement it but I don’t care. Can you help me.

  2. Anonymous Guest

    Hi! Your best options for first class are going to be Lufthansa (only bookable within two weeks) or Singapore, and both would have connections in Germany. There aren’t any carriers offering first class between Italy and the US, though there are some solid business class products.

  3. Ethan Nemeth New Member

    I flew AA from ORD-FCO a few days ago. Not first class, but excellent service for business. I found it to be very nice and better than a couple first class products I’ve flown on. They operate the same aircraft (777-200) FCO-JFK. Not first class, but a excellent non-stop business class option.

  4. LadyDiBs New Member

    Emirates flies direct to Milano and they seem to have a top notch 1st class product (as well as business class).
    I’ve been doing my own research to fly that route and I know that you can convert your AMEX points to the Emirates Skywards program (not sure about the Sapphire points). Also Emirates has lounges at JFK and Malpensa and they provide a chauffeured car to take you to the airport and from the airport once you arrive at your destination (and vice versa) within I think 50km though.
